The future of the global chloroacetyl chloride market looks promising with opportunities in the herbicide, active pharmaceutical ingredient, and chemical production markets. The global chloroacetyl chloride market is expected to reach an estimated $744 million by 2030 with a CAGR of 6.2% from 2024 to 2030. The major drivers for this market are growing demand for agrochemicals and pharmaceuticals, increasing production of adrenaline for medical usage, and expanding focus on sustainable farming practices and eco-friendly agrochemicals.
Lucintel forecasts that, within the manufacturing process category, chlorination of acetyl chloride is expected to witness higher growth over the forecast period.
Within the application category, active pharmaceutical ingredients will remain the largest segment over the forecast period.
In terms of regions, APAC will remain the largest region over the forecast period.

Country Wise Outlook for the Chloroacetyl Chloride Market
The market for chloroacetyl chloride has seen important changes over the past few years, driven by increasing industrial demand and advances in chemical manufacturing. It is also a part of many chemical synthesis processes as an essential intermediate for manufacturing pharmaceuticals, agrochemicals, and specialty chemicals. These changes are driven by several factors, including emerging industrial applications, regulatory changes, and advancements in production technologies. Various economic conditions, political frameworks, and technological advancements in each region play major roles in these developments. An understanding of recent trends in the chloroacetyl chloride industry markets, such as Germany, India, China, Japan, and the United States, offers useful insights into the global chloroacetyl chloride landscape.
United States: Recent updates about this market have centered on adhering to laws and regulations regarding the environment and ensuring sustainability in the United States. Production methods have been affected by stricter rules from the Environmental Protection Agency (EPA) concerning how hazardous chemicals are handled or disposed of. This has resulted in manufacturers investing heavily in advanced filtration systems as well as safer handling technologies. Additionally, more energy-efficient production efforts aimed at reducing carbon footprints are being emphasized. The goal is to strike a balance between environmental sustainability objectives while simultaneously meeting rising demand from the pharmaceuticals and agrochemical sectors.
China: China's robust chemical manufacturing sector, combined with growing industrial needs, has caused notable growth in the chloroacetyl chloride industry. New large-scale plants that use modern technology to enhance their efficiency and output levels are currently under construction to further increase production capacities. Additionally, there has been a significant move towards the modernization of chemical production facilities through automation, resulting in improved quality products at lower operational costs. Other policies implemented by the government to support the chemicals industry include incentives and subsidies, which have made China one of the biggest players globally within the chloroacetyl chloride sector.
Germany: In Germany, high-quality manufacturing coupled with a strong industrial base leads to growth in its chloroacetyl chloride market. German firms are working on process optimization and greener chemistry to meet stringent EU regulations on chemical safety and environmental impact. Recent developments have seen investments in R&D to develop more sustainable production processes with fewer by-products. Moreover, Germany's strategic position within the European market makes it a significant source of chloroacetyl chloride for its neighboring countries, thereby supporting its export-driven industry.
India: The pharmaceuticals and agrochemical industries are driving India's chloroacetyl chloride sector growth. With many companies establishing new factories and adopting technologies to increase their output, the country is boosting its domestic production capacities to meet this demand. Furthermore, the government's focus has been on improving logistics infrastructure and regulatory frameworks as they relate to the chemicals industry, fostering growth in this market. Additionally, cost-effective methods of production, together with compliance with quality regulations, have been emphasized as matters of importance for competing globally.
Japan: Advanced technology coupled with strong regulation characterizes Japan's chloroacetyl chloride market. These include investments in modern chemical processing techniques that save time during production and limit the environmental effects caused by these activities. Japanese companies also concentrate on producing high-purity chloroacetyl chloride used in precision industries like pharmaceuticals and electronics. The country's push for sustainability, along with adherence to regulations, ensures that these practices remain consistent while maintaining compliance with international standards, thereby sustaining a competitive edge over other countries operating in international markets.
